Journey Through Jewish History: Alluring Spain 2016

Travel Dates: Tuesday June 28, 2016

Join Torah in Motion for a unique and intellectually inspiring trip to Spain designed by Dr. Marc Shapiro.

  • See the medieval synagogues in Toledo
  • Visit the windmills immortalized by Cervantes
  • Experience Shabbat in Gibraltar, a unique experience
  • Enjoy the magnificence of Barcelona, one of Europe’s most exciting cities
  • See the medieval synagogue in Cordoba

We'll be visiting Madrid, Cordoba, Gibraltar, Grenada, Barcelona, Gerona, and many other sites off the beaten track. This trip promises to be an unforgettable Spanish experience, with a focus on places of Jewish interest. A central feature of the tour will be Dr. Shapiro's expert discussions of the many places we will visit, making the trip nothing less than a travelling classroom. In addition, we will be joined by expert local guides who will provide their own angle.
